Understanding REST API Basics

A REST API helps two software systems talk to each other online. It's different from other APIs because it follows REST architecture. This focuses on stateless communication using standard HTTP methods like GET, POST, PUT, and DELETE.

These methods handle different tasks:

  1. GET retrieves data
  2. POST creates resources
  3. PUT updates resources
  4. DELETE removes resources

REST is based on key principles like client-server architecture, stateless communication, cacheability, a uniform interface, and layered systems. These principles shape how RESTful APIs are designed and used. They help make APIs scalable, reliable, and efficient in software development.

Following these principles allows developers to create strong and adaptable APIs. This improves how different systems can work together on the internet.

Security Measures

Encryption methods like SSL/TLS are used to secure data transmission in RESTful APIs. This keeps data safe from unauthorized access as it travels between the client and server.

Authentication and authorization in APIs are managed using mechanisms such as API keys, OAuth tokens, or JWT tokens. By verifying user identities with these credentials, APIs can allow access to authorized resources only.

Monitoring tools like intrusion detection systems and real-time threat analysis are important for quickly detecting and responding to security threats. They help identify suspicious activities, analyze risks, and prevent security breaches before any damage is done.

Implementing Document Generation API

Code Examples for Integration

When integrating a RESTful API for document generation, certain code examples are very important. These include HTTP requests, JSON payloads, and authentication tokens.

Developers can use HTTP POST requests to send structured JSON payloads to the API endpoint. This data is necessary for generating the document.

Proper authentication mechanisms, like API keys or OAuth tokens, should be implemented for secure integration. This protects sensitive information during document creation.

Error handling codes, such as HTTP status responses, can help troubleshoot issues and make the integration process smoother.

Following these best practices and using secure APIs effectively, developers can integrate RESTful APIs for document generation confidently and easily.

Automating Document Generation Processes

When choosing a REST API for automating document generation processes, consider:

  1. Ease of document generation system integration with existing systems.
  2. Scalability to handle large volumes of documents.
  3. Availability of robust documentation and support resources.

To implement security measures:

  1. Use authentication mechanisms like OAuth tokens.
  2. Implement encryption techniques for data transmission.
  3. Use role-based access control to restrict user permissions.

Best practices for streamlining document generation processes with RESTful APIs:

  1. Design efficient API endpoints.
  2. Implement caching strategies to reduce server load.
  3. Conduct regular performance testing to identify and address bottlenecks.

Additionally, leverage asynchronous processing techniques to:

  1. Improve system responsiveness.
  2. Handle processing tasks more effectively.

Reviewing API Documentation

When you review API documentation, it's important to check for specific components:

  1. Clear endpoints
  2. Methods for authentication
  3. Request and response formats
  4. Explanations of error codes
  5. Examples of how to use the API

These elements help developers understand how to work with the API effectively. To make sure the documentation is easy to follow, focus on:

  1. Organized content
  2. Consistent formatting
  3. Descriptive naming conventions
  4. Clear explanations

To ensure the information is accurate, test API endpoints, compare the documentation with actual API behavior, review code samples, and ask for feedback from other developers. By taking these steps, developers can easily navigate through API documentation and seamlessly integrate the API into their projects.
